Cupido only plays forward while Tambling is willing to run and work his way up the field. That goal against the Hawks where Tambo forced the turnover from Hay in the middle of the ground, dished off the footy via the handball then ran on to collect the return handball and sprinted before slotting it home. There was also that clever knock on through a pack to a teammate when he was on the Hawthorn goal side at half-back. Although Tambling is still pretty raw and has a long way to go IMO he at least has the work ethic. As CUB said it's a case of wait and see.

Cupido also had shoulder problems when he was up in Brisbane which kept him off the park.
